Output 043e8a359de7a8808cd4503cbc778634f04437854e85f51ca2e221ddd3c9b27f:1

value
21254958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4be871dfc62180673d20ddeb3c5db32bb6ce874 OP_EQUAL
address
3Gi6z7CQhxjzUdZLDbRy428BH5hshMjoK2
transaction
043e8a359de7a8808cd4503cbc778634f04437854e85f51ca2e221ddd3c9b27f
spent
true